Call for Contributions: Sustainable Cooling in Cities – Policy Workshop – Cork, Ireland, 28 October 2026
As part of IEA EBC Annex 97 – Sustainable Cooling in Cities, a workshop will be held on 28 October 2026 in Cork, Ireland, in collaboration with venticool and AIVC. The event will bring together researchers, practitioners, policymakers, and other stakeholders to discuss sustainable cooling, overheating risks, environmental quality, and climate-resilient built environments.
The workshop will be organised in two complementary sessions:
Morning Session (09:00–12:00): Indoor Environment
The morning programme will focus on topics related to the indoor environment, including:
- Indoor overheating
- Thermal comfort
- Indoor environmental quality (IEQ)
- Resilient cooling strategies
- Related work from initiatives such as IEA EBC Annex 80
The main geographical and climatic interest of this session is on temperate climates, corresponding to Köppen-Geiger climate group C, including the subtypes Csa, Csb, Csc, Cfa, Cfb, Cfc, Cwa, Cwb, and Cwc. Contributions addressing Mediterranean, oceanic, humid subtropical, and temperate highland contexts are particularly welcome.
Afternoon Session (13:00–16:00): Outdoor Environment
The afternoon programme will primarily feature contributions from IEA EBC Annex 97 participants and will address topics such as:
- Urban heat mitigation
- Outdoor thermal comfort
- Public space design
- Nature-based cooling solutions
- Local climate adaptation
- Policy development and implementation
